Overview

A US military aircraft recently transported 205 Indian nationals back to Amritsar, India, following their deportation from the United States. This operation highlights ongoing immigration challenges and the enforcement of US immigration policies.

Key Details

  • Deportation Context: The individuals were deported due to violations of US immigration laws, which include overstaying visas and illegal entry.
  • Arrival in Amritsar: The deportees arrived at Amritsar’s Sri Guru Ram Dass Jee International Airport, where they were received by local authorities.
  • Government Response: Indian officials are coordinating with US authorities to ensure the safe return and reintegration of these individuals.
